The history of Chester is deeply entwined with the Delaware River, a port city since its colonial beginnings, witnessing the ebb and flow of trade and industry. For generations, its economy was powered by shipbuilding, manufacturing, and steel production, leaving behind a legacy of sturdy, utilitarian architecture and a resilient, working-class spirit. Though the grand factories have largely fallen silent, the echoes of their past reverberate in the town's character. Chester is also home to the historic Old Chester Courthouse, a landmark that has stood witness to centuries of local governance and community life, and the vibrant Widener University, which injects a youthful energy into the historic landscape, fostering a dynamic interplay between its storied past and its evolving present.
